  What You’ll Do

  As an OHA you would be responsible for the delivery of a full range of Occupational Health (OH) duties including Case management, all the Mandatory, Regulatory and General fitness medicals eg Rail industry medicals, Safety Critical medicals, Health Surveillance, Train Drivers medicals , HAVS 3 (is an added advantage), Health and Wellbeing services;

  More specifically:

  Work in conjunction with our customers, either at a medical centre or customer site or remotely to provide support, advice and guidance to managers and employees in relation to sickness absence, workplace environment, risk assessment, stress management and return to work following absence.

  Lone working: Ability to work in medical centre and onsite without close or direct supervision. Conducting health surveillance /various Medical assessments, Case management, Network rail , Train Drivers medicals and Safety Critical medicals. (Training can be provided).

  Provide advice to managers and HR regarding staff who are considered incapable of undertaking their normal duties and responsibilities whilst working within the guidelines of customers policy

  Provide advice and support to managers and supervisors undertaking risk assessments relating to health matters affecting their staff.

  To ensure that knowledge is maintained of up to date legislation and best practice relating to all Occupational Health issues.

  To work with head office to increase utilization of the service in the described area and to carryout dashboard work where required.

  To participate in the network learning opportunities, to undertake updates on clinical improvements and actively complete performance related clinical goals. For example, delivery an update at a network day on a clinical innovation relevant to the network.

  Required Qualifications

  Degree, Diploma or Certificate in Occupational Health (and be on Part 3 of NMC Register) with evidence of continual professional development

  A qualification in Hand Arm Vibration and experience of collecting samples for drug and alcohol testing using chain of custody protocols is desirable

  The ability to carry out medicals / surveillance including audiometry, spirometry, skin assessment, HAVS and safety critical medicals

  Experience in the Rail industry to undertake Train Driver Medicals with additional training

  The ability to conduct case management assessments face to face and remotely.

  Have the ability to work closely and effectively with HR, Health & Safety professionals and our occupational health partners

  Have the ability to identify key health issues and assist in the development and provision of procedures and solutions

  Have the ability to travel between sites, must have business insurance

  Be competent in the use of computers including Microsoft and Excel software
